Day 1

Arrival and Transfer to Murchison Falls National Park via Ziwa Rhinos for Rhino Tracking

Arrival and Transfer to Murchison Falls National Park via Ziwa Rhinos for Rhino Tracking

After an early morning pick-up from Kampala or Entebbe, begin your journey to Murchison Falls National Park. En route, stop at Ziwa Rhino Sanctuary for rhino tracking on foot. Continue to the park and visit the top of Murchison Falls, where the Nile River forces itself through a narrow gorge before plunging dramatically below. Enjoy the spectacular scenery before proceeding to your lodge for dinner and overnight.

Day 2

Morning Game Drive and Afternoon Nile Boat Cruise

Morning Game Drive and Afternoon Nile Boat Cruise

Wake up early for a game drive on the northern bank of the park in search of lions, elephants, buffaloes, giraffes, leopards, Uganda kobs, hartebeests, and numerous bird species. Return to the lodge for lunch and relaxation. In the afternoon, enjoy a boat cruise along the Victoria Nile to the base of Murchison Falls, where you may spot hippos, crocodiles, elephants, and many water birds.

Day 3

Transfer to Kibale Forest National Park

Transfer to Kibale Forest National Park

After breakfast, depart Murchison Falls and travel south through scenic countryside to Kibale Forest National Park, the primate capital of East Africa. The drive offers beautiful views of tea plantations, rural communities, and rolling hills. Arrive at your lodge in the evening for dinner and overnight.

Day 4

Chimpanzee Tracking and Bigodi Wetland Walk

Chimpanzee Tracking and Bigodi Wetland Walk

After breakfast, head to the park headquarters for a briefing before entering Kibale Forest in search of habituated chimpanzees. Spend time observing these fascinating primates as they feed, communicate, and swing through the forest canopy. Return to the lodge for lunch. In the afternoon, enjoy a guided walk through the Bigodi Wetland Sanctuary, known for its birds, monkeys, and local community experiences.

Day 5

Transfer to Queen Elizabeth National Park and Kazinga Channel Boat Cruise

Transfer to Queen Elizabeth National Park and Kazinga Channel Boat Cruise

After breakfast, drive to Queen Elizabeth National Park, passing through the scenic crater lakes region. Arrive in time for lunch at your lodge. In the afternoon, enjoy a boat cruise on the Kazinga Channel, which connects Lake Edward and Lake George. The channel hosts large concentrations of hippos, crocodiles, elephants, buffaloes, and numerous bird species.

Day 6

Morning Game Drive and Transfer to Bwindi Impenetrable National Park

Morning Game Drive and Transfer to Bwindi Impenetrable National Park

Wake up early for a game drive in the Kasenyi Plains, searching for lions, elephants, buffaloes, Uganda kobs, hyenas, and other wildlife. After breakfast, depart for Bwindi Impenetrable National Park through the Ishasha sector, famous for its tree-climbing lions. Arrive at your lodge in the evening for dinner and overnight.

Day 7

Gorilla Trekking Experience

Gorilla Trekking Experience

After an early breakfast, proceed to the park headquarters for a briefing before entering the forest to search for a habituated gorilla family. The trek may take several hours depending on the gorillas’ location. Once found, spend one magical hour observing these gentle giants in their natural habitat. Return to the lodge for relaxation and celebrations after this unforgettable wildlife encounter.
